Well, I have no idea how to install the C-Clip for the pommel insert. Oooo and when drilling a hole in any of the MHS parts do i need oil? for heat reduction? Thank you for your time.

I used a screwdriver or two to lever my C-Clip into the pommel.

You don't need oil for drilling into MHS pieces unless you are using a large bit (3/8" for the recharge port).

there are actual c-clip pliers availible at most hardware or autopart stores, they are usually called snap ring pliers or retaining ring pliers ,and they sometimes come it sets for inside c-clips and for outside c-clips.

as for drilling aluminum the best thing to use is kerosene, but if you dont have any WD-40 works good to.. good luck.

Alwase make a small piolet hole and before you drill use a center punch to make the inital mark to keep the bit from walking. and using an eye level(your eye that you see with) to make sure its pritty straight up and down and straight with the hilt.

Its best to have a extra person for this but when you go thru the work to keep the hole nice and straight the end result will be fan tastic.
